Understanding Different Types of Flute Bags
Flute bags come in various styles, each designed to meet different needs and preferences. When shopping for a bag under $15, it’s essential to understand the types available. The most common options include gig bags, hard cases, and padded bags. Gig bags are lightweight and designed for portability, making them ideal for musicians on the go. They often feature minimal padding but are easy to carry, with adjustable straps and pockets for accessories.
Hard cases, although usually more expensive, can sometimes be found in budget options. These cases provide maximum protection, ensuring your flute is safe from impacts and scratches during transport. They may include molded interiors and additional compartments for accessories, making them a solid choice for flutists who travel frequently. Lastly, padded bags combine features from both gig bags and hard cases, offering a balance of portability and protection.
When selecting a flute bag, consider where you’ll be taking your instrument most often. For regular gigging musicians, a lightweight gig bag may suffice, while students needing extra protection might prefer a padded or hard case. Understanding your needs will inform your choice and help ensure you select the best bag for your flute.

Maintaining and Caring for Your Flute Bag
Proper care and maintenance of your flute bag can prolong its lifespan and keep your instrument safe. Start by regularly cleaning both the interior and exterior of your bag using a damp cloth. For fabric bags, consider using a specialized cleaner to target any stains or grime that accumulates from daily use. Ensure that the bag is completely dry before storage to prevent mildew or mold from forming.
Additionally, avoid overloading your bag with excessive items, as this can lead to unnecessary wear on the zippers, seams, or straps. Each component of your bag has a designed limit, and exceeding this can compromise both the aesthetics and functionality. Be mindful of how you store your flute as well; place it in the bag carefully and ensure that it fits snugly in its designated compartment to avoid shifting during transport.
Lastly, inspect the bag periodically for any signs of damage or wear. Early detection of issues like frayed straps or broken zippers can prevent more significant problems down the line. Taking the time to maintain your flute bag will ensure it continues to serve you well throughout your musical journey.

3. Closure Mechanism
The closure mechanism of a flute bag plays a significant role in its security and ease of use. Common types of closures include zippers, Velcro, and snap buttons. Zippers provide a secure seal, preventing the flute from accidentally slipping out, while Velcro offers easy access when you need to quickly grab your instrument. Assess which type of closure fits your needs and preferences before making a purchase.
In addition to the closure type, consider the strength and reliability of the mechanism. A zipper with sturdy teeth, for example, will be more reliable than a cheap alternative that might break easily. Check for reinforced stitching or other features that enhance the durability of the closure, ensuring that your investment is secure.
